It doesn’t seem necessary to throw Victor Oladipo on this list, as it’s obvious he will be traded. Oladipo was acquired for this purpose.
Oladipo’s $9.5 million expiring salary will be pivotal for the Rockets from a salary filler standpoint. It’s unknown whether the 31-year-old will actually take the court this season, as he suffered a gruesome torn patellar injury on his left knee during the opening round of the 2023 playoffs.
A healthy Oladipo is capable of providing a scoring punch off the bench, as evidenced by his 2022-23 campaign with the Miami Heat, in which he averaged 10.7 points In 26.3 minutes of action. Oladipo provided value in the 2021-22 season also, posting averages of 12.4 points, 47.9 percent from the field, and a career-best 41.7 percent from long-range, albeit in a small sample size of just eight games.
The Heat could use a healthy version of Oladipo and the Los Angeles Lakers could also, so there would be a trade market for him, if healthy. But in all actuality, his biggest value is likely as salary-filler, allowing a team to get rid of long-term salary.
